Solution
Given , Graph of f(x) = x^4 - x^2
and , Graph of g(x) = x^4 - x^2 - 2
when graph of f(x) shifted to 2 units down then
the new graph produced is of g(x)
g(x) = x^4 - x^2 - 2
when graph of f(x) shifted to 2 units downward
then g(x) = x^4 - x^2 - 2
